Judge: Peter Wilson, Case: 30-2022-01289191, Date: 2023-06-15 Tentative Ruling

The Court has considered the unopposed Motion to Approve Proposition 65 Settlement and Stipulated Consent Judgment and has the following concerns:

 

1.    The Option 2 Warning should include “birth defects”. Consent Judgment, §3.4.

2.    What authority governs or approves a warning in the form of Option 2?

3.    Plaintiff does not address the nature, extent and number of violations. This information is necessary to determine whether the amount of civil penalties comply with Health & Safety Code § 25249.7(b)(1). 

4.    Paragraphs 3 and 4 in the proposed Order refers to an “additional settlement payment in lieu of civil penalty” but it is unclear to what this is referring.

 

Accordingly, the Court CONTINUES the hearing to August 3, 2023. Any supplemental papers should be filed at least 9 days prior to the hearing and served on the Attorney General, along with a proof of service.

 

Plaintiff is ordered to give notice, including to the Attorney General and to file a proof of service.
